The Role of Transvaginal Ultrasound: A Closer Look from Within
Transvaginal ultrasound, where a specialized probe is inserted into the vagina, offers a more detailed and close-up view of the reproductive organs. This technique can enhance the detection of a bicornuate uterus, as it allows for better visualization of the uterine cavity and its internal structures. By carefully examining the shape and contours of the uterus, a skilled sonographer may be able to identify the presence of a septum or a heart-shaped appearance, indicating a bicornuate uterus.
Challenges and Limitations: The Elusive Nature of Diagnosis
Despite the advancements in ultrasound technology, diagnosing a bicornuate uterus remains challenging. The accuracy of detection heavily relies on the experience and expertise of the sonographer, as well as the clarity of the ultrasound images. In some cases, a bicornuate uterus may go undetected until later stages of pregnancy or even during a cesarean section. Therefore, it is important to remember that a negative ultrasound result does not definitively rule out the possibility of a bicornuate uterus.
Beyond Ultrasound: Exploring Further Diagnostic Modalities
In cases where a bicornuate uterus is suspected but not clearly visible on ultrasound, additional diagnostic modalities may be considered. Magnetic Resonance Imaging (MRI) can provide a more comprehensive assessment of the uterine structure and aid in confirming the diagnosis. This imaging technique utilizes powerful magnets and radio waves to create detailed images of the internal organs, offering a more accurate depiction of the uterine shape and identifying potential abnormalities.
